Biography

You'll only have seen him on screen if you get Challenge TV, and even then he plays second fiddle to Donna Air's hosting role on The Cooler.

Nevertheless, Iain is an active behind-the-scenes figure in game shows. He was the question writer for Shooting Stars, and has written for or generally meddled with many successful comedy shows, as the list alongside demonstrates.

As of 2019, he's Head of Comedy and Entertainment for UKTV, and so commissions shows for Dave and Gold. And he once sent us a nice email, so he can't be all bad.

Trivia

He came up with the concept of the "Cubiscus", the excellent grabbing-machine end game seen in Families at War.
